Friedrich August von Hayek

Friedrich August von Hayek 1899-1992
"A society that does not recognize that each individual has values of his own which he is entitled to follow can have no respect for the dignity of the individual and cannot really know freedom." F. A. von Hayek.

Friedrich August von Hayek was an eminent Austrian born economist who won the 1974 Noble Memorial Prize in Economic Science. He was a prolific writer and his Collected Works are currently being published by the University of Chicago Press and Routledge, which take up nineteen volumes. He is regarded as a one of the leading economists of the twentieth century and his works continue to be influential in business-cycle theory, political and social philosophy, legal theory and comparative economic systems. He spent over seventy years promoting the superiority of capitalism over socialism and challenged the prevailing opinions of many other social scientists and intellectuals during his life.
